Mimi Chi-Yan Kung, a talented actress, entered the world on September 17, 1963, in the vibrant city of Hong Kong, which was then a British Crown Colony, rich in cultural heritage and historical significance.
As a renowned actress, Mimi Chi-Yan Kung has made a lasting impact on the entertainment industry, with a diverse range of iconic roles to her name. Her impressive filmography includes the critically acclaimed "Journey to the West" (1996),a timeless classic that has captivated audiences worldwide.
In addition to her work in film, Mimi Chi-Yan Kung has also made a significant contribution to the world of television, starring in the popular series "The New Adventures of Chor Lau-heung" (1984),which has become a beloved staple of Hong Kong's television landscape.
Moreover, her impressive body of work also includes her iconic role in the cult classic "Encounter of the Spooky Kind" (1980),a film that has become a benchmark for Hong Kong's horror-comedy genre.
